Can GTA 4 Save PS3? How About Take-Two?

Colin Sebastian, an analyst with Lazard Capital Markets, said that although he expects the Xbox 360 to get the lion's share of GTA IV software sales, Sony could capture as much as 40% of the market. "Historically, the franchise is more closely tied to Sony than to Microsoft, so there's brand equity there if you will," he said.

"The GTA franchise was born and raised on PlayStation," a Sony spokesperson told Wired.com in an email. The company predicts that GTA IV's launch this month will move sales of PlayStation 3 hardware: "There is strong brand association with consumers between PlayStation platforms and GTA and even though it is hard to predict the exact bump in PS3 hardware sales caused by GTA IV, it will certainly be a significant driver of hardware as consumers don't forget that heritage."
